Exploit Vector Mapping, within the context of cryptocurrency, options trading, and financial derivatives, represents a structured analysis of potential attack pathways targeting vulnerabilities in systems and protocols. It moves beyond simple vulnerability identification to map the sequence of actions an adversary might take to achieve a malicious objective, considering both technical and operational factors. This mapping process is crucial for proactive risk management, enabling the prioritization of countermeasures and the development of robust defensive strategies across diverse financial landscapes. Understanding these vectors allows for a more nuanced assessment of systemic risk and the potential for cascading failures.
